Starship is probably the most innocent (Black Friday also doesn't have a ton of sex jokes, but there's a lot of swearing and dark themes) but some of the non-musical stuff like Little White Lie, Movies Musicals and Me (if you skip the 50 Shades of Grey episode), Wayward Guide, and Poe Party are the most "family friendly". Of course, none of those are Starkid's best content either.
